Wood blewit mushrooms: Wooden blewits are thought of edible, while they are doing result in allergic reactions in a few of the men and women that take in them. The allergic reactions are more extraordinary if the mushrooms are consumed raw, Though they do bring about some signs or symptoms even when eaten cooked. These mushrooms are cultivated in the uk, France, and also the Netherlands, and they can even be found in the wild. Culinarily, this assortment is commonly sautéed in butter or perhaps a product sauce, made use of as an omelette filling, or tossed right into a soup or stew.

Straw Mushrooms (Volvariella volvacea): Straw mushrooms get their identify in the rice straw which they mature on. Also called “paddy straw mushrooms,” they mature Normally in the new, steamy weather of southeast Asia. Though straw mushrooms are basically unheard of and hardly ever eaten in The us, They're very talked-about around the globe, rating 3rd in consumption of all mushrooms globally, appropriate powering Agaricus bisporus (the common field mushroom that is usually witnessed in suppliers) and Lentinus edodes (the medically beloved shitake mushroom). In China, straw mushrooms are actually a Element of the culinary traditions for more than two thousand several years and counting.
